I am not good at working, so I asked Shop to do the installation.
The power supply is taken from Battery, but the Instruction Manual for handling "Battery may rise and should be disconnected when not in use." and it is necessary to disconnect the Body's connecting wires (3 wires) except when driving. (This is not a hassle and I don't feel it is a minus point). (This is not a hassle and I do not feel it is a minus point.
Another thing to keep in mind is that 'Protect them from the sun when they are at rest.' This means.
It is not a problem in light sunlight, but if the TimeaTuckerBody is exposed to strong sunlight and heats up too much, the LCD Panel will not display. This has been confirmed by contacting the Manufacturer. Therefore, I cover the body with a Towel during intervals in the Circuit on days with strong sunlight.

I've tried a lot of things and this is the one I choose.
I am a heavy user who runs the Circuit several dozen times a year.
I guess it depends on how you run, but the wear and tear on the Knee Slider is ridiculous, so it was a problem for me.
I've been using a Zurch product for many years, but I was looking for a different manufacturer because the model changed and it became smaller.
After trying several Knee Sliders from several manufacturers, I now choose this one.
Number of yearsQuantity:I try to buy in bulk from Webike because I use Set.
The first factor to look for in a knee slider is abrasion resistance.
If you don't rub much, you probably don't care that much, but I'm 176cm tall and not a small guy. I am 176cm tall, not a small guy, but I have a lot of opportunities to ride my 1.2 inch MINI, and even when I drive without being conscious of it, I spend a lot of time rubbing.
I don't think I'm pushing my knee too hard in terms of running style, but compared to my peers, I seem to be replacing my knee sliders more often.
I think it's simply because I've been running for a long time.
In such an environment, this product is acceptable.
Even if they are in a similar price range, they can be troublesome and expensive to return if they decrease too quickly.
I have tried several Knee Sliders and I think this is the best product in terms of true cost performance.
There is a segment of the population that loves interchangeable sensors, and I've tried them myself. "Magic tape will be removed less frequently." I could not find any Merit other than
I also tried an interchangeable Manufacturer's product that prides itself on its firmness, but the wear did not vary greatly from this one, and I thought the balance was poor considering the selling price.

Pay attention to the magnetic sensor mounting position and direct sunlight
First of all, the installation position of the Magnetic Sensor is troubling.
In the case of the Race car, I think it has a tight Under Cowl, so the installation position is quite restricted.
I have it over the Under Cowl around where the Side Stand was originally attached, but sometimes it misreacts …
It would be nice if the manufacturer could provide some installation examples.
Also, it stops working in direct sunlight in summer, or maybe it malfunctions? Or rather, it malfunctions?
Keep them in the shade when they are stopped.
If it's running, the wind may cool it down, but I've never had it go wrong.
Also, if you take the power supply directly from the battery, the battery will rise even if the power supply is off.
It is necessary to build a Relay or to remove the power Coupler each time (the instruction manual notes the latter).
I just bought a Lithium ion battery and the voltage was like 2V and I was shaking.
It is a mystery why there is so much dark current when it can be turned on and off.
